While the coronavirus crisis in Amravati too has deepened with over 1400 cases being reported in the last three days.
The reason for the rise in infections is due to the recently conducted panchayat elections, a change in weather and return of crowd in some areas.
An official statement from the District Magistrate is likely to come by Thursday evening.
Meanwhile, Maharashtra Water Resources Minister Jayant Patil has been found to be coronavirus positive. On Twitter, the minister also said he is doing fine and taking appropriate medical advice. I have tested Covid positive. Whilst I am doing fine, I am taking appropriate medical advice and hope to recover soon. I shall be undertaking my duties via video-conference, he tweeted.
